Last week’s Republican presidential debate raised a few pertinent questions, to wit: Is Republican National Committee Chairman Reince Priebus so naive he believes that left-wing moderators are interested in fair journalism over ideological bias? That kind of naivete borders on incompetence (“RNC chairman blasts CNBC for ’deeply unfortunate’ debate questioning,” Web, Oct. 28).
How in the world could Mr. Priebus agree to such an obviously biased group of moderators who used their own agenda to ridicule, attack and denigrate the Republican Party? Clearly Mr. Priebus doesn’t understand the politics of the left or the bias of the mainstream media.
The Republican Party cannot afford to have Mr. Priebus in any position to make decisions regarding the eventual debates with Hillary Rodham Clinton. Consequently he should resign his position immediately and turn it over to a grown-up who actually understands the realities of modern-day politics.
